Underwriting Support Specialist: Environmental & Energy

Markel is a fortune 500 company specializing in insurance, reinsurance, and investment operations. The Underwriting Support Specialist will act as a resource and integral member of the underwriting team, providing essential support in client servicing and workflow management to meet agents' expectations and ensure quality service.

Responsibilities

Serve as point of contact for agents/brokers by gathering information on behalf of the underwriters, answering questions, resolving low complexity issues, facilitating overall serving of accounts and processing business transactions not requiring review/signoff by an underwriter
Take necessary measures to obtain information needed to finalize inquiries/transactions and maintain a suspense and follow-up system for outstanding underwriting items
Ensure accuracy of information inputted into all appropriate systems and verify that all necessary documentation is in the file
Routinely communicate with team members, agents/brokers and other key business partners to research and gather necessary information to review, analyze and complete transactions
Utilize and adhere to internal guidelines, procedures and service standards to ensure that all assigned work/transactions are processed in a timely manner (yet accurately) and meet compliance standards
Participate in problem solving activities to define problems, identify root causes, design and test solutions, implement solutions, and utilizes continuous improvement methodologies to improve processes & procedures in an effort to work more efficiently & effectively and permanently eliminate problems
Under Underwriter direction, attached appropriate forms and makes policy changes as requested
Establish, support, and maintain effective relationships and/or regular contact with clients and build strong relationships with employees across the organization
Participate in special projects and other duties as assigned to assure efficient operation of the team, customer needs are met, and business results are achieved
